A differenza dei dimmer tradizionali o multisede che regolano i livelli di tensione mediante reostati, i dimmer ELV impiegano la modulazione di ampiezza degli impulsi (PWM) per controllare con precisione la potenza erogata all'apparecchio di illuminazione, ottenendo un'esperienza di dimmerazione pi\u00f9 fluida e accurata.<\/p><p>La dimmerazione ELV funziona spegnendo il carico elettrico sul bordo d'uscita o alla fine della forma d'onda CA. Conosciuti anche come dimmer elettronici o trailing edge, questi dimmer controllano l'alimentazione del carico manipolando il rapporto tra tempo di accensione e di spegnimento, noto come \"duty cycle\", in combinazione con la tensione relativa al carico. Questo livello di controllo consente di regolare con precisione la luminosit\u00e0 delle luci LED.<\/p><div class=\"insert_portfolio_outer_wrapper\"><h3>Ispiratevi ai portafogli dei sensori di movimento Rayzeek.<\/h3><p>Non trovate quello che volete? Tuttavia, per i sistemi a tensione di rete che funzionano con la tensione standard di 120 V, \u00e8 possibile utilizzare un dimmer di base.<\/p><\/div><\/div><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><div class=\"wp-block-group glossary_faq_q\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><h3 class=\"wp-block-heading\" id=\"h-what-is-the-difference-between-a-dimmer-and-a-elv-dimmer\">Qual \u00e8 la differenza tra un dimmer e un dimmer ELV?<\/h3><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q_a\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><p>Un dimmer ELV \u00e8 progettato specificamente per dimmerare l'alimentazione elettronica di una lampada alogena a bassa tensione. A differenza di un normale dimmer, un dimmer ELV taglia il bordo d'uscita dell'onda di potenza per ridurre il ronzio. Pertanto, ELV, Trailing Edge e Reverse Phase si riferiscono tutti alla stessa funzionalit\u00e0.<\/p><\/div><\/div><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><div class=\"wp-block-group glossary_faq_q\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><h3 class=\"wp-block-heading\" id=\"h-do-led-lights-need-elv-dimmer\">Le luci a LED hanno bisogno di un dimmer ELV<\/h3><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q_a\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><p>Mentre la maggior parte dei LED integrati richiede l'uso di un dimmer ELV, alcuni marchi europei utilizzano il sistema 0-10 volt.<\/p><\/div><\/div><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><div class=\"wp-block-group glossary_faq_q\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><h3 class=\"wp-block-heading\" id=\"h-how-many-led-lights-can-be-on-one-dimmer-switch\">Quante luci LED possono essere collegate a un interruttore dimmer?<\/h3><\/div><\/div>\n\n<div class=\"wp-block-group glossary_faq_a\"><div class=\"wp-block-group__inner-container is-layout-constrained wp-block-group-is-layout-constrained\"><p>Varilight suggerisce di collegare un massimo di 10 lampade LED a un modulo dimmer.
